Flavor Profile
Tasting Notes
Colour
white wine
air Nose
very saline and sharply coastal at first. Lots of raw lemon juice, pink sea salt, pears, sheep wool, oysters, petrol, lime juice, coal dust and a slightly fragrant heathery aspect. There are a few classical Bowmore fruit notes as well but they’re really buried under this ocean of seashell, minerals, brine and pin-sharp freshness. Very ‘millimetric’ as Serge would say. With water: super medicinal now. Lots of embrocations, bandages, ointments and starchy notes. Cornflour, putty, rock pools and wet seaweed
restaurant Palate
superb! Lemon oils, scented waxes, citronella, sandalwood, seaweed, beach pebbles, squid ink and even a sprig of mint. The fruits are pronounced as well. Still a fair bit of oily sheep wool but also lots of raw barley, kiln smoke and sourdough. With water: still sharp and pure but with an added layer of fruits such as tangerine and melon with a fuller thickness to the texture
timer Finish
long, full of raw barley, smoke, peat embers, lemon peel, yeast, wood ash and brine
